    I have bought over 30 different HID kits from Ebay over the past 3 years personally and for friends. All I can say is that the McCulloch is probly the best brand but you have to pay for it(250 bux). Ive had a CATZ kit in my Regal for about 3 years already (450 bux). All of the sub 100 dollar kits will last you about a year or so before the ballasts or bulb fails. I dont mind too much because you accumulate extra parts.
